All About PDR Services
Paintless Dent Repair, or PDR, is a sophisticated process that helps fix minor damages and dents from automotive panels while preserving the vehicle's paint finish. This process requires professional equipment to gently push or pull the damaged area to its factory condition. The equipment is made to reach behind the damaged panel, allowing precise manipulation that leaves the paint intact.
This approach is perfect for small to mid-sized dings, particularly those caused by hail, recreational equipment, or light impacts.
In terms of cost analysis, Paintless Dent Repair usually emerges the more economical choice versus standard dent repair techniques. Traditional repair techniques usually require sanding, filling, and repainting, which requires more work hours but could potentially harm the original paintwork.
On the other hand, PDR preserves the original paint and needs considerably less material and time. This results in a smaller overall cost and often a speedier turnaround. By opting for PDR, you're selecting a repair method that avoids potential reductions in your vehicle's resale value due to mismatched paint or noticeable filler compounds.
Key Benefits of Opting for Paintless Methods
You've seen how paintless dent repair (PDR) can save your hard-earned money compared to traditional repair techniques, but the benefits don't stop there. This approach isn't just budget-friendly but also offers substantial environmental gains, making it an ideal choice for environmentally aware car owners like yourself.
Importantly, PDR doesn't require paint, chemicals, or fillers typically used in traditional body repairs. This absence of toxic materials means no chance of harmful emissions, maintaining air quality and minimizing your vehicle's environmental footprint. By removing the need for paint, PDR avoids volatile organic compounds (VOCs) that standard painting methods emit, which are detrimental to both environmental and human health.
Additionally, the high efficiency of PDR concerning both time and resources translates into lower energy consumption. Traditional repair methods typically require extensive sanding, painting, and drying processes that not only require significant amounts of electricity but also lengthen your vehicle's time off the road.
In contrast, PDR can be done in a fraction of the time, which enhances its cost-effectiveness by getting you back on the road quicker and reducing labor costs.
Selecting paintless dent repair isn't just a cost-effective option—it's a step towards greener vehicle maintenance.
What Types of Damage Can We Fix?
Car enthusiasts commonly ask about the extent of damage paintless dent repair (PDR) can effectively fix. It's important to recognize that this technique is particularly successful in fixing small to medium-sized dents, especially in situations where there's no damage to the paint finish.
PDR is perfect for fixing shallow dents that usually happen because of common occurrences such as parking lot bumps or small projectiles like stones. This technique proves especially useful for fixing creases, which are typically more challenging because of the distorted surface.
What's more, PDR is the go-to technique for fixing hail damage, which typically causes numerous dents over your vehicle's panels. As these dents generally don't affect the paint layer, they can be effectively restored using PDR, protecting your car's pristine finish.
You'll find PDR extremely useful for correcting door dings, which commonly happen in parking lots. Unlike conventional repair methods that could involve sanding, filler, or repainting, PDR operates by precisely reshaping the affected area back to its original form, guaranteeing no trace of the damage remains.
If you're dealing with non-penetrative dents in which the paint isn't compromised, PDR can effectively restore your automobile's aesthetics without the complications of conventional repair techniques.
Our Skilled Technicians' Approach
Our experienced professionals initiate the paintless dent repair (PDR) process by thoroughly examining the severity of the damage on your vehicle. They precisely examine each dent, evaluating its size, depth, and location to identify the most effective repair approach. This initial step is crucial as it guides the precise dent repair methods that'll be implemented.
After completing the evaluation, our experienced professionals leverage their comprehensive knowledge to skillfully approach the damaged area from behind. They could disconnect trim pieces or panels to get to the backside of the damaged area. With specialized tools, they then skillfully manipulate the metal to its initial position from the interior outward. This process is meticulous and demands a precise approach and a deep understanding of metal properties.
Throughout the entire process, our experienced professionals make certain that your vehicle's original paint remains intact, eliminating further damage. This technique not only protects your automobile's look but also protects its structural integrity and market value.
